勉強したことのメモ

webプログラマ見習いが勉強したことのメモ。

PHPでCSVファイルを作って開くと「SYLKファイルが云々」のアラートが出た

   

データベースのログを整形してCSVファイルを生成し、ダウンロード及びエクセルで開こうとすると「Excelは'aaa.csv'がSYLKファイルであることを確認しましたが……」みたいなアラートが出た。

CSVファイルの生成部分に関してはPHPのソースを使いまわしていたので問題はなさそう。Excelもアップグレードとか何もしていない。

で、調べてみると「1行目のデータがIDになっているとSYLKファイルとご認識される」らしい。全然知らんかった。注意する。

 

■参考サイト

http://pasofaq.jp/office/excel/sylk.htm

 - PHP

  関連記事

images
PHPで画像のフォーマット(拡張子)の変換

画像のアップロードでjpg/png/gif形式を受け付けつつ、 最終的にjpgで ...

msyql-image
MySQLiでFOUND_ROWS(全件数取得)

MySQLiでFOUND_ROWS(全件数取得)。 $sql = ' SELEC ...

images
phpでhtmlをpdf化。あと無理矢理画像をpdf化

画像をphpでpdf化したかった。 検索してみるもサーバー側の設定を必要とするも ...

images
WordPressで任意のクエリをページに出力するプラグイン

先日、「WordPressで任意のクエリをページ内で出力する方法 」という記事で ...

jquery_logo
jQueryとprototypeの共存

prototypeを先に使っているがjQueryに移行してきている ページで、尚 ...

images
htmlspecialcharsを通してMySQLに格納したものを元に戻して出力

MySQLにHTMLタグを入れたくない場合にhtmlspecialcharsを使 ...

images
var_export

PHPのソースでvar_exportという見慣れない関数があった。 Aファイルか ...

images
PHPで配列かどうかを調べる

配列か否かを調べたいケースがあり、確認すると ばっちりそのままの関数発見。 is ...

images
PHPのLocationに変数を入れる

ページ遷移したい際に使う、 header("Location:./aaa.htm ...

images
PHPでプロキシ経由で他サーバーに接続

PHPでfile_get_contentsやcurlで他サーバに接続する際に自サ ...